行业资讯

云服务器端口转发命令:轻松搞定你的云端数据交互小助手

2025-11-12 10:29:58 行业资讯 浏览:5次


嘿,亲爱的小伙伴们,今天咱们要聊聊云服务器里的“秘密武器”——端口转发命令!如果你听到“端口转发”就觉得像是走迷宫,别担心,我会用最轻松好懂的方式让你秒变高手。什么?你问我为什么要搞端口转发?那当然了,要让云端的服务和外界“自由跑跳”,必须得有点神操作呀!比如你想远程连接MySQL数据库、或者搞个私有网页服务器,端口转发是你的秘密武器,懂了吗?不过别着急,先听我细细道来。或者说,想不想在云端“翻个身”,实现一键穿透墙的梦?那就跟我一起往下看吧!

在云服务器里,端口转发就像是在玩“穿墙术”——让本来被隐藏在“密室”里的服务,能被你轻松访问。很多人用的命令,核心其实就是“ssh”,这个看似普通的工具,其实暗藏大招。尤其是“ssh -L”参数,简直就是为端口转发量身打造的。比如说,你在本地电脑想连接云服务器上的数据库,直接用“ssh -L”把云服务器的端口“变身”成你本地的端口,就能像开外挂一样,直达目标。想象一下:你只需在命令行打几个字,就能“走进云端的秘密花园”。

那么,常用的端口转发命令长啥样?举个最常用的例子。如果你要转发本地端口1234到云服务器的80端口(假设你打算架个网站),可以用这样一条命令:
ssh -L 1234:localhost:80 user@your-cloud-server.com。这句话的意思就是:我在本地的1234端口,通往云服务器的80端口。你只要在浏览器输一下:http://localhost:1234,就像开启了穿墙模式一样,直接看到云端的网站,简直比魔法还厉害!

如果你觉得“呃,好像还可以转发到其他端口”?当然可以!比如你想连接数据库,MySQL默认端口是3306,运行这个命令:
ssh -L 3306:localhost:3306 user@your-cloud-server.com。这时候,打开你的MySQL客户端,连接localhost:3306,就像坐在云端端口上“蹭网”一样轻松!

云服务器端口转发命令

某些小伙伴喜欢用PuTTY(Windows用户的“神器”)来搞端口转发,别怕,不需要学会魔法咒语,只要在“连接→SSH→隧道”里设置,输入对应的“源端口”和“目的地址”。其实操作流程简单得很,把“源端口”填你希望用的端口,把目标地址填“localhost:目标端口”即可。懂了吗?如果不懂,无妨,玩游戏想要赚零花钱就上七评赏金榜,网站地址:bbs.77.ink,里面资源丰富,保证让你学到飞起!

但要注意啦!端口转发是不是“万能钥匙”?没错,但也要“用得好”。比如说,你要确保云服务器的安全组规则允许你的请求穿越,否则就像在自动门前踩了空气——硬碰硬也走不进去。另外,如果云主机开启了防火墙(比如iptables或firewalld),还得好好调调,让端口“顺利通”。

还有一种“高级玩法”,叫做“动态端口转发”,也就是“SOCKS代理”。这不仅能让你穿透公司墙,还能实现整个网络的代理。这玩意儿其实就是先在云端开启一个“代理服务器”,然后用“ssh -D”命令启动:
ssh -D 1080 user@your-cloud-server.com。之后,把你的浏览器设置成“代理”,就像开挂在网海中自由遨游!

话说回来,别忘了,端口转发虽然酷炫,但也要留意一些“坑”。比如说,大量连接可能让你的云服务器“体检”变差,甚至被封掉。务必遵守云服务商的规定,避免“黑店操作”。在操作之前,知道掌握云提供商的端口开放策略非常重要,否则,搞再多的花哨命令也是白搭。想学得更深?可以关注云服务商的API接口,自动化脚本让你像个“程序猿神”,一键搞定所有端口转发需求—更有趣的是,还能节省不少时间呦!

别忘了,有时候“端口”也像女生的心一样需要“呵护”。确保你用的命令正确,端口没有被占用,安全组允许访问,才能让“穿墙运行”变得顺利无比。有个“隐藏技巧”——用“autossh”保持端口转发的持续连接,即使掉线也能自动重连,堪比“永不放弃的铁人”。

好了,带你一步步走进了“云端端口转发”的神秘世界。只要你敢试,用得巧,不怕“被封”,云中自有无限可能。记住:操作前提前备份配置,毕竟,谁也不想在云端“淹没”在一堆乱码里不是吗?还有那些“秘密技巧”,让你的云操作像吃饭一样自然——下一次打算搞个“私奔”般的远程服务,别忘了这个神器!